site stats

Mysql command create table with primary key

WebTo create a new table with a column defined as the primary key, you can use the keyword PRIMARY KEY at the end of the definition of that column. In our example, we create the table product using a CREATE TABLE clause, with the names of the columns and their respective data types in parentheses. We choose the column id as the primary key of this ... WebWe can also create a table using records from any other existing table using the CREATE TABLE AS command. For example, ... To create a primary key, we can write the following command. In MySQL. CREATE TABLE Companies ( id int, name varchar(50), address text, email varchar(50), phone varchar(10), PRIMARY KEY (id) ); ...

A Basic MySQL Tutorial - Medium

WebWe can create a primary key in two ways: CREATE TABLE Statement; ALTER TABLE Statement; Let us discuss each one in detail. Primary Key Using CREATE TABLE … WebTo create a PRIMARY KEY constraint on the "ID" column when the table is already created, use the following SQL: MySQL / SQL Server / Oracle / MS Access: ALTER TABLE Persons … size 18 clothes cheap https://mcmanus-llc.com

How to add a primary key to a MySQL table? - lacaina.pakasak.com

WebMay 1, 2024 · create table authors ( id int auto_increment not null primary key, first_name varchar (20), last_name varchar (20) ); create table books ( id int auto_increment not null … WebALTER TABLE goods ADD PRIMARY KEY(id) As to why your script wasn't working, you need to specify PRIMARY KEY, not just the word PRIMARY: alter table goods add column `id` int(10) unsigned primary KEY AUTO_INCREMENT; Existing Column. If you want to add a primary key constraint to an existing column all of the previously listed syntax will fail. Web3. Select Tables sub-menu, right-click on it, and select Create Table option. We can also click on create a new table icon (shown in red rectangle) to create a table. 4. On the new table screen, we need to fill all the details to … sushmita sen boyfriend list

MySQL Create Table - javatpoint

Category:SQL PRIMARY KEY Constraint - W3School

Tags:Mysql command create table with primary key

Mysql command create table with primary key

How to Create MySQL Composite Primary Keys Simplified 101?

WebKeyword PRIMARY KEY is used to define a column as a primary key. You can use multiple columns separated by a comma to define a primary key. Creating Tables from Command Prompt. It is easy to create a MySQL table from the mysql> prompt. You will use the SQL command CREATE TABLE to create a table. Example. Here is an example, which will … WebJul 14, 2024 · How to Create Table in MySQL using Command Line. The following statement creates a new table named “Persons”: CREATE TABLE Persons (. PersonID int …

Mysql command create table with primary key

Did you know?

WebThis guideline is especially important for InnoDB tables, where the primary key determines the physical layout of rows in the data file. CREATE INDEX enables you to add indexes to existing tables. CREATE INDEX is mapped to an ALTER TABLE statement to create indexes. See Section 13.1.8, “ALTER TABLE Statement” . WebMay 13, 2024 · Use the ALTER TABLE to Add Primary Key in MySQL. We realize after creating a table that a particular column within a table must be a primary key to avoid …

WebApr 13, 2024 · In Structured Query Language, type the following command: CREATE DATABASE students; Create a Table and Insert the data. For creating a table in your database, you need to use the following SQL syntax: CREATE TABLE table_name ( column_Name_1 data type (size of the column_1), column_Name_2 data type (size of the … WebMay 1, 2024 · Just a quick note here today that if you need some MySQL `create table` examples, I hope these are helpful. I created them for some experiments I ran last night. They show the MySQL create table, primary key, and foreign key syntax: create table authors ( id int auto_increment not null primary key, first_name varchar (20), last_name …

WebSep 13, 2024 · To create a Primary key in the table, we have to use a keyword; “PRIMARY KEY ( )” Query: CREATE TABLE `Employee` ( `Emp_ID` VARCHAR(20) NOT NULL ,`Name` … WebThis video is based upon the concept of database and MySQL. In this video I will show you how to create a table inside database in SQL.Please access the MySQ...

WebJan 21, 2024 · Method 2: Adding MySQL Composite Primary Key in Existing Table; 1) Creating MySQL Composite Primary Key while Table Creation. To create MySQL composite primary key during table creation you can follow the steps. Suppose you want to create Customers with the fields (order_id, product_id, amount) table with a MySQL Composite …

WebTo create a PRIMARY KEY constraint on the "ID" column when the table is already created, use the following SQL: ALTER TABLE Persons ADD PRIMARY KEY (ID); To allow naming … sushmita sen children s fatherWebMySQL creates new columns for all elements in the SELECT. For example: mysql> CREATE TABLE test (a INT NOT NULL AUTO_INCREMENT, -> PRIMARY KEY (a), KEY (b)) -> … sushmita sen boyfriend rohman shawl ageWebA primary key is a NOT NULL single or a multi-column identifier which uniquely identifies a row of a table. An index is created, and if not explicitly declared as NOT NULL, MySQL will declare them so silently and implicitly. A table can have only one PRIMARY KEY, and each table is recommended to have one. InnoDB will automatically create one in ... sushmita sen childhood picsWebcreate_table :global_feeds, {:id => false} do t t.string :guid t.text :title t.text :subtitle t.timestamps end execute "ALTER TABLE global_feeds ADD PRIMARY KEY (guid);" If you're not on mySQL you should change the query in the execute command to work on your DB engine. I'm not sure if you can do that on SQLite though. And don't forget to put ... sushmita sen fatherWebAug 31, 2024 · MySQL Create Index in New Table. To create an index at the same time the table is created in MySQL: 1. Open a terminal window and log into the MySQL shell. mysql -u username -p. 2. Create and switch to a new database by entering the following command: mysql> CREATE DATABASE mytest; Query OK, 1 row affected (0.01 sec) mysql; USE … size 18 fashion blog ukWebYou can create one table from another by adding a SELECT statement at the end of the CREATE TABLE statement: CREATE TABLE new_tbl [AS] SELECT * FROM orig_tbl;. MySQL creates new columns for all elements in the SELECT.For example: mysql> CREATE TABLE test (a INT NOT NULL AUTO_INCREMENT, -> PRIMARY KEY (a), KEY(b)) -> … sushmita sen crowning momentWebOct 18, 2009 · A table can only have one primary key. However, the primary key can consist of multiple columns, e.g. CREATE TABLE salaries ( dep_id SMALLINT UNSIGNED NOT … sushmita sen dating history